Belgium was one of the first countries in Europe to embrace football and is currently number one on the FIFA world ranking: it is safe to say that Belgium has football in its veins. Despite being only a small country with 11 million inhabitants, Belgium is home to many world-class football players. The Belgian Red Devils’ Golden Generation has only increased the sport’s popularity, which resulted in an industry with a significant economic impact.
